As a Personal Banker, you will be the first point of contact for branch customers, responsible for delivering exceptional service while deepening relationships. The role supports customers in achieving their financial goals by understanding their banking needs and ensuring compliance with risk and regulatory requirements.

What you will be doing

Support the branch team to achieve personal lending, service, and operational outcomes
Manage member enquiries and provide tailored information on Qudos products and services
Assist with personal lending applications, including data entry, document preparation, and member communication
Handle complex member needs, cash transactions, and account maintenance
Support members with digital banking and escalate queries or complaints as needed
Record sales activity in Prosper and follow up on future opportunities and referrals
